If you’re like many homeowners, chances are you don’t pay much attention to your garage door as long as it’s working. However, if your garage door breaks, you may wish that you had invested time and energy into routine maintenance. There are two basic types of garage door springs: extension and torsion. Torsion springs are an ideal option for many residential garage doors near Pflugerville and Austin, as they can handle heavy loads and tend to last for about 20,000 open and close cycles.
